The 1950's barn, nestled on the corner of a forty-acre farm on the Indiana/Illinois state line, has been renovated into an event venue that could comfortably seat over 350 people. Some highlights include a foyer that could be driven through, the ballroom boasting five chandeliers, heating/cooling, kitchenettes, changing rooms, restrooms, an outdoor pavilion, numerous outdoor ceremony locations, and grounds with mature trees.

What Makes Illinois Wedding Venues Special?

Illinois offers remarkable regional diversity in wedding settings. Downtown Chicago venues like The Gwen and Private Dining by Sepia treat you to stunning skyline views and sophisticated urban atmospheres. Head to the suburbs and you'll discover spots like Itasca Country Club with picturesque golf course backdrops. Central Illinois charms with converted barns and historic properties while Southern Illinois tempts with vineyard settings and lakefront locations.

Venue costs in Illinois typically range between $9,600 and $11,700 which aligns well with the national average of $6,500-$12,000 (representing about 25% of your total wedding budget).

What Are the Cost Breakdowns for a 150-Guest Wedding in Illinois?

For a typical 150-guest wedding totaling $56,164 your budget will likely break down as:

  • Venue: $10,665 (19%)
  • Catering: $8,532 (15%)
  • Florists: $7,466 (13%)
  • Bar Services: $6,826 (12%)
  • Photographers: $4,835 (9%)
  • Videographers: $4,408 (8%)
  • Planners: $3,851 (7%)
  • Bands/DJs: $1,750 (3%)
  • Cakes/Desserts: $668 (1%)
  • Hair & Makeup: $400 (1%)

How Can You Maximize Value at Illinois Wedding Venues?

September stands as Illinois' most popular wedding month so you'll need to book well in advance. Most venues are secured about 15 months (457 days) ahead with venue inquiries typically representing couples' first wedding planning step.

Look for venues offering comprehensive packages that include essentials like tables chairs and audio equipment. This approach often delivers better value than piecing services together separately.
